Kojo Antwi: There’s too much praise-singing in the music industry

The celebrated Ghanaian musician has advised budding artistes to hasten slowly and learn from the older generation

Afro-pop, highlife and reggae musical artiste, Kojo Antwi also known as ‘Mr Music Man’ has said there is too much praise-singing in the Ghanaian music industry.

He said this has prevented budding artistes from reaching the height of their music careers.

Speaking with Kent Mensah on Sunday Night on Asaase Radio, Kojo Antwi said the problem in the Ghanaian music industry is that the environment is not conducive for the young ones to learn and improve.

He said it is important for the up and coming artistes to continue to remain relevant in the music industry and “we need to accommodate these young ones…”

“I have never stepped on stage and felt as though I wanted it to end. I always wish that my performances never end.”

He added, “I think our environment is not too fertile for most of these young ones; first of all, I put a bit of the blame on the vibrant social media that has emerged. 

“I think there’s too much praise-singing [in the music industry]. You have these young ones who come out with a song and then you hear people using [certain] words for them that makes it impossible for you to speak to them …”

“We kill the dreams of these young ones because we stop them from listening to the older generation that they can learn from…”
